Synchronizing ebook page between devices

I'm wondering if there are any ebook readers which I haven't tried yet which do a good job of synchronizing which page I'm on between different android devices.

I've been using Moon+ Reader for this. It does a decent job of synchronizing, but I would like an alternative due to its inability to preserve page breaks within chapters. I'm currently reading a book which primarily has two long chapters and losing the breaks due to extra spaces between paragraphs as in the physical copy makes it harder to read.

I am currently using FBReader for this book. The formatting of the book works fine and it does synchronize, but it doesn't do it transparently the way Moon+ does so I'm still looking around for alternatives.

I do have a copy of Mantano but dislike the way they force people to pay for their cloud instead of using Dropbox. If I don't find a better alternative I might give in and pay the $20 per year (or reduce the number of books to under 1000 and cut it to $10 per year--realistically I don't really need to keep all those books on there).

I have also used Aldiko in the past but it had some problems.

Any other suggestions?

I've subscribed to the Mantano Cloud service, and while it works as described, I've found Moon+ to be much easier to use. Moon "just does" synchronization, and I don't have to remember to select specific books for synch. It's also free to use with an existing Dropbox or GDrive account, which helps. I'm going to drop my Mantano Cloud subscription when it expires next year.

It's a shame Mantano doesn't adopt Moon+'s approach to sync, or Moon+ improve their rendering engine to be on par with Mantano or Google.
